Latest Patents

Shenyi Li holds a patent for a few-mode optical fiber. This optical fiber design includes a core and a cladding that encloses the core. The cladding consists of a first inner cladding surrounding the core, a first high-refractive-index mode filter layer surrounding the first inner cladding, a second inner cladding surrounding the first high-refractive-index mode filter layer, a second high-refractive-index mode filter layer surrounding the second inner cladding, and an outer cladding surrounding the second high-refractive-index mode filter layer. This innovative design aims to improve the efficiency and capacity of optical fiber communications. He has 1 patent to his name.
